summaryrefslogtreecommitdiffstats
path: root/src/uscxml/concurrency
diff options
context:
space:
mode:
Diffstat (limited to 'src/uscxml/concurrency')
-rw-r--r--src/uscxml/concurrency/tinythread.cpp7
-rw-r--r--src/uscxml/concurrency/tinythread.h2
2 files changed, 4 insertions, 5 deletions
diff --git a/src/uscxml/concurrency/tinythread.cpp b/src/uscxml/concurrency/tinythread.cpp
index 56363b7..4a99259 100644
--- a/src/uscxml/concurrency/tinythread.cpp
+++ b/src/uscxml/concurrency/tinythread.cpp
@@ -31,15 +31,14 @@ freely, subject to the following restrictions:
#include <process.h>
#endif
-
namespace tthread {
-uint64_t timeStamp() {
- uint64_t time = 0;
+unsigned long long int timeStamp() {
+ unsigned long long int time = 0;
#ifdef WIN32
FILETIME tv;
GetSystemTimeAsFileTime(&tv);
- time = (((uint64_t) tv.dwHighDateTime) << 32) + tv.dwLowDateTime;
+ time = (((unsigned long long int) tv.dwHighDateTime) << 32) + tv.dwLowDateTime;
time /= 10000;
#else
struct timeval tv;
diff --git a/src/uscxml/concurrency/tinythread.h b/src/uscxml/concurrency/tinythread.h
index 537cc04..aa8335b 100644
--- a/src/uscxml/concurrency/tinythread.h
+++ b/src/uscxml/concurrency/tinythread.h
@@ -152,7 +152,7 @@ freely, subject to the following restrictions:
/// the std::mutex class.
namespace tthread {
-uint64_t timeStamp();
+unsigned long long int timeStamp();
/// Mutex class.
/// This is a mutual exclusion object for synchronizing access to shared